Utility employees run for water awareness

The staff either walked or ran 6km from the Mhlathuze head office to the Nsezi treatment plant

ALMOST 200 Mhlathuze Water employees on Wednesday participated in the utility’s fourth annual ‘Water-thon’ to raise awareness of the need to use water responsibly and sparingly.

The staff either walked or ran 6km from the Mhlathuze head office to the Nsezi treatment plant.

‘Water has no substitute and it is central to all forms of life,’ said the utility.

Sandile Mgwaba and Mduduzi Gumede make a run for it

‘Everyone has a responsibility conserving the precious resource.

‘This platform is used to drive this message across to our internal employees as ambassadors of water and remind them that water is instrumental in ensuring good health and well-being.’
